Matt Kemp was selected by the Los Angeles Dodgers in the sixth round of the 2003 MLB Draft and spent parts of 10 seasons over two stints with the team.
The Dodgers are hiring former big leaguer Matt Kemp in an advisory role.
The Los Angeles Dodgers aren't done adding to their talent off the field. President of baseball operations Andrew Friedman and general manager Brandon Gomes have surrounded themselves with talented ex-big leaguers, from Raul Ibañez to Nelson Cruz.
Matt Kemp is among a long line of Los Angeles Dodgers draft success, and his time with the organization included two separate stints. Kemp emerged as a National League MVP candidate from 2006-2014 and was a productive reserve outfielder upon returning to the Dodgers organization for the 2018 season.
The Los Angeles Dodgers are expected to hire longtime outfielder Matt Kemp in an advisory role, USA Today's Bob Nightengale reported Sunday morning. It is unclear what exactly Kemp's new position would entail, but he won't be the first former player to join the club behind the scenes this offseason.

The Dodgers traded outfielder Yasiel Puig to the Reds in December 2018, sending him, Matt Kemp, Alex Wood, and Kyle Farmer to Cincinnati in exchange for Josiah Gray, Jeter Downs, and the contract of Homer Bailey.
On June 28, 2008, the Los Angeles Dodgers defeated the L.A. Angels at Dodger Stadium despite Jered Weaver and Jose Arredondo not allowing a hit. Matt Kemp scored the only run in the Dodgers’ 1-0 victory.
